The 'Antique Book Collector's Guide' by Nicholas Basbanes is a comprehensive resource dedicated to the appreciation, identification, and collection of antique books. It offers insights into the history of rare books, tips on collecting, valuing, and caring for vintage editions, and anecdotes related to prominent collections and collectors. The book aims to serve both novice enthusiasts and seasoned collectors seeking to deepen their understanding of the antique book world.
